A television host, news anchor, weatherman, actor, stand-up comedian, radio show host and more all rolled in one, Mitch English is known for his quick wit & unpredictability. Not only is Mitch part of the B & B Team, but he also hosts the nationally syndicated television show Daily Flash, seen all across America every weekday. Out of all the titles Mitch has, “Dad” of 4 kids is his most important.

Mitch studied Broadcast Meteorology at Mississippi State University and for 10 years was the “spark plug” for the national television show The Daily Buzz, serving as both host and weather anchor. When he left that show, he set out on the road visiting TV shows across the country to “Get Techy” by showcasing the latest in tech and gadgetry. During that time, he was also the Social Media/Tech Contributor for WOFL FOX 35 in Orlando, Florida.

Mitch later ventured behind the camera to become the Executive Producer of Good Morning San Diego at powerhouse station KUSI-TV in San Diego, California before heading to KOKH-TV FOX 25 where he served as Reporter, then Morning News Anchor of FOX 25 Morning News. Eventually, Mitch transitioned into the role of Co-Host every weekday morning for the station’s Lifestyle Show, Living Oklahoma.

Throughout his career, Mitch has co-starred in several theatrical releases, network television shows, hosted and produced a morning TV talk show in Salt Lake City, Utah and has anchored weather at WCBS-TV in New York City.

Mitch also toured with The Big and Tall Comedy Tour performing stand-up on stages throughout the country. He began his broadcasting career in 1990 and soon after, worked on-air at WDJR in Dothan, Alabama. It was there where he began working with Jerry Broadway… and for that, we’re sorry.
